Our Mission

We will advocate for health care professionals by being a strong presence at the Montana state legislature, developing relationships with lawmakers and offering our expertise as well as testimony on applicable bills. We intend to provide legal advocacy, through our association with the Montana Family Foundation, to protect basic human and civil rights related to preservation of life, the right to bodily integrity, medical freedom, and the ability to engage in unconstrained professional medical decision-making tailored to the needs of the individual person.
We will provide education on truthful, balanced, medically sound, research-based information on the prevention and treatment of common medical conditions that affect health, quality of life and longevity. We will encourage the sharing of information and healthy discussion between providers through our website and roundtable discussions in key locations.
We will work to re-establish the patient-provider relationship that may have been damaged over the handling of the Covid crisis.
We will provide networking and community for like-minded health care professionals, coordinating speaker bureaus for educational services and/or testimony, and retain a panel of expert witnesses for litigation purposes.

Three Pillars Of Focus

MEDICAL FREEDOM / BODILY AUTONOMY
We believe in individual rights guaranteed by our US Constitution and Bill of Rights. Therefore, unelected governmental institutions, such as Public Health (HHS) cannot institute and impose laws or mandates, but rather only make recommendations regarding public health matters. Only elected representative governments (local, state, or federal) may establish laws or mandates.
We believe that each individual has the right to personal health care choices, which should be made of free will (without coercion or threat of reprisal), and fully informed (meaning that they understand their diagnosis, recommended treatment or procedure, short-term and long-term risks, benefits, and all alternative options). Each individual must receive full informed consent if the recommended treatment is experimental or authorized for emergency use only and must understand that they are enrolling in human experimentation, and that long-term effects are not known.
We believe that physicians and licensed healthcare practitioners have the right to treat their patients with FDA-approved medications as they see fit, even if they are using that medication in an “off-label” manner. Unelected governmental institutions such as the CDC and FDA, and corporations such as retail pharmacies may not prohibit treatment or interfere with the doctor-patient relationship.
Uphold and protect patient’s privacy–a person shall not be forced to disclose protected health information to his/her employer, human resources personnel, corporate attorney, or any other nameless/faceless committee. This is in direct violation of HIPPA, GINA (Genetic Information Non- Disclosure Act), and ADA regulations.
